1. Handstand Happiness
Go out on a limb and try this childhood move you once loved. If you do not have a regular handstand practice, place hands on the ground and lean up against the wall for support. This will help build your upper body strength and give you a new upside view of the world. For a detailed guide on proper form, check out the official Handstand guide at Yoga Journal. This move is a great precursor to more advanced variations like the Taraksvasana.
2. Fallen Triangle
The fallen triangle is another move that will help you bring your yoga poses to the next level. From downward dog, bring your left leg up in the air. Breathe out and bring your leg to touch your right elbow. Then breathe in and, with the leg straight underneath your armpit, place your right heel to the floor and lift your right arm. Stretch and breathe for up to 5 breaths. It’s an incredible way to build core stability and shoulder strength simultaneously.
3. Yoga Splits
Begin in downward facing dog and then follow the tips in this video to perform a yoga split. Do not be discouraged if you are unable to complete a full split; do the best that you can and work your way up to increased flexibility. Consistency is key when it comes to deep stretches like this.

7. Taraksvasana – Handstand Scorpion
The Taraksvasana, or handstand scorpion, is one of the most challenging poses that cranks up your yoga fitness to the next level. Work your way up to this move, as it requires significant strength in your abdominal muscles, shoulders, and back. You can find more advanced techniques on the Yoga Alliance resource page. This pose helps strengthen the abdominals, shoulders, and back muscles while dramatically improving your overall balance.
